Joining the ranks of Assassin’s Creed and Bioshock, THQ is bundling a free copy of an old game with the PS3 version of Saints Row: The Third. By redeeming the online pass included in new copies of the game, players will get access to a free download of a complete copy of Saints Row 2, so if you somehow manage to finish The Third’s dildo-swinging, hoverbike riding adventure quickly, you can now go back and play through The Third’s still good predecessor for the low, low price of free.
THQ originally promised that the PS3 version would have exclusive content, but fans who purchased the game on launch yesterday noticed that all the versions of the game were identical in terms of content. This new generous offer by THQ seems like a quick response to fix that gaffe, but regardless of their motivation, who can complain about getting a game for free? It’s worth noting that Assassin’s Creed: Revelations on PS3 also includes a free copy of the original Assassin’s Creed, and next year’s Bioshock Infinite will also include a free copy of the original Bioshock, so this bonus Saints Row game seems to be part of a concerted effort by third parties and Sony to try to motivate people to buy the PS3 versions over their 360 counterparts.
